Lincoln Memorial University Acceptance rate and admissions statistics

Lincoln Memorial University has an acceptance rate of 63% and is among the top 25% of the most difficult universities to gain admission to in the United States. The university reports the admission statistics without distinguishing between local and international students.

Total Men Women
Acceptance Rate 63% 59% 64%
Applicants 3,603 1,148 2,437
Admissions 2,255 674 1,571
Freshmen enrolled full time 345 130 215
Freshmen enrolled part time 12 2 10

1,287 students enrolled in some distance education courses.

567 enrolled exclusively in distance education.

Costs per year: Tuition, Housing, Fees

The average net cost to attend Lincoln Memorial University is $21,447 per year, calculated as the sum of the average cost of tuition, room and board, books, and supplies, reduced by the amount of average financial aid received.

The final cost of attendance varies for each student based on household income, residency, program, and other factors.

    Biography

    Ralph Edmund Stanley was an American bluegrass artist, known for his distinctive singing and banjo playing. He began playing music in 1946, originally with his older brother Carter Stanley as part of the Stanley Brothers, and most often as the leader of his band, the Clinch Mountain Boys. He was also known as Dr. Ralph Stanley.

    Biography

    Robert Scot Shields is an American former professional baseball relief pitcher. He played his entire baseball career with the Los Angeles Angels of Anaheim of Major League Baseball (MLB). He was the last member of the Angels' 2002 World Series championship team remaining on the team's roster when he announced his retirement in 2011. Shields pitched in 491 games for the Angels, ranking him second all-time in games pitched for the team behind Troy Percival (579).
